Welcome to 348A Greenhill Road, Glenside A stylish two-storey residence that combines modern comfort, functional design, and a blue-chip eastern suburbs address. Built in 2010, this home offers a refined lifestyle with space to grow, relax, and entertain, all just minutes from the CBD. Positioned within the highly sought-after Glenunga International High School zone, this is a home that delivers both immediate liveability and long-term value. Thoughtfully designed across two levels, the layout creates a natural balance between family connection and private retreat. Upstairs, two well-proportioned bedrooms with built-in robes are serviced by a central bathroom, offering an ideal zone for children or guests. Downstairs, multiple living areas provide flexibility for everyday living, working from home, or entertaining in comfort. At the heart of the home, a light-filled open-plan kitchen, dining, and living area creates a warm and inviting space. The kitchen is both functional and stylish, featuring stainless steel appliances, a striking granite island bench, and generous storage, perfect for everything from daily meals to hosting family and friends. Seamless indoor-outdoor living continues with a tiled alfresco entertaining area, providing a private and weather-protected space to enjoy year-round gatherings. To the rear, a second courtyard offers a more intimate setting, complete with a landscaped garden and space to unwind. The master suite is privately positioned on the ground floor, offering a peaceful retreat with built-in robe, ensuite, and direct access to the outdoor area-creating a sense of separation and comfort. Designed for year-round enjoyment, the home is equipped with ducted evaporative cooling upstairs, split system air conditioning to key living areas, and gas heating to the rear living space. Perfectly located just moments from Burnside Village, Frewville Foodland, local cafes, and public transport, with the CBD only minutes away, this address delivers both lifestyle and convenience in equal measure. A home of quality, comfort, and enduring appeal, ready to welcome its next chapter. Key Features: Zoned for Glenunga International High School and Linden Park Primary Flexible four-bedroom layout, ideal for families or work-from-home living Master bedroom on ground floor with ensuite and outdoor access Light-filled open-plan living with multiple living zones Kitchen with granite island bench and quality stainless steel appliances Tiled alfresco entertaining area plus private rear courtyard Ducted evaporative cooling (upstairs) and split system air conditioning Gas heating to rear living area Automatic carport with remote access and additional off-street parking Tasmanian Oak hardwood staircase Built-in robes to upstairs bedrooms and ample storage throughout Fourth bedroom adaptable as study or home office
